There was a time when St Patrick's Day in Dublin was celebrated on only the day itself - March 17th. But over the years things have changed and now, instead of just having a one-day party, Dublin hosts the five-day St Patrick's Festival that has much more than a parade.

At 8.30pm on Saturday 26 March 2011, hundreds of millions of people across the globe will switch off the lights of homes and businesses for one hour – Earth Hour. This is the world’s largest public action for the environment, acknowledging a commitment to go beyond the hour with actions that benefit the planet in the year ahead.
